SY51 XCO is a 2001 Mitsubishi Shogun in Red with a 3,200cc diesel engine. This vehicle has been through 9 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 66.7%.
Across all 2001 Mitsubishi Shogun models, the average MOT pass rate is 71.2% with a typical mileage of 103,809 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.
The most common reason a Mitsubishi Shogun fails its MOT is brake pipe excessively corroded, accounting for 75,153 recorded failures. If you're considering buying SY51 XCO,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Mitsubishi Shogun typically stays on UK roads for around 37 years. At 25 years old, this Mitsubishi Shogun is well into its expected lifespan but still has years ahead.
